cors のテストをしようとして躓く

curl: (7) Failed to connect to https://example.localhost port 443: Connection refused.

curlでsame-origin と cross-origin のテストをしようとコンテナ内のターミナルから実行したところエラーが起きた。解決しようと無駄な鉄砲数撃ちゃ当たる作戦で対応した記録を残しておく。

無駄撃ちした内容

# docker-compose.yaml

version: "3"

services:

	php-apache:

		build:

			context: .

			dockerfile: ./docker/lang/Dockerfile

		container_name: lamp-p

		extra_hosts:

			- example.localhost:192.168.0.1

#			- example.localhost:127.0.0.1

		image: php:8.0-apache

		ports: 

			- 443:443

		volumes:

			- html:/var/www/html

		working_dir: /var/www/html

エラーが発生した時点の ip が「192.168.0.1」でコンテナの resolve.conf の ip が「127.0.0.11」だったのでなんかちゃうなと感じてコメントアウト部分の「127.0.0.1」に変えたら通った。ホストからはブラウザでは表示できるがターミナルからはアクセスできない。